    GitHub Copilot: A Professional-Grade AI Assistant

    GitHub Copilot, first launched in 2021, is a feature-rich AI coding assistant that intuitively complements the developer’s workflow. Leveraging the unmatched generative capabilities of OpenAI’s Codex, it predicts and suggests coherent lines of code, repetitive functions, and algorithms based on descriptive user prompts. Its core benefit lies in significantly accelerating coding tasks while integrating deeply with GitHub repositories.

    Tabby: A Flexible, Open-Source Alternative

    Tabby, introduced in 2023, provides an open-source take on AI-powered coding assistants. Designed for developers who want more control over their data and workflow, Tabby allows self-hosting, making it a favorite for users with technical expertise aiming for cost savings and transparency. However, this flexibility comes with a steeper learning curve and less automation when compared to Copilot.
    Language Support:
    – GitHub Copilot natively supports over 25 programming languages, including Python, JavaScript, TypeScript, Java, C++, and Ruby.
    – Tabby supports a range of common languages but may require additional configuration to accommodate emerging or niche languages.

    IDE Support:

    GitHub Copilot integrates seamlessly with commonly used IDEs, delivering a virtually installment-free experience within platforms like VS Code, JetBrains (e.g., IntelliJ and PyCharm), and Neovim. Setting it up takes only a few minutes.

    Tabby also supports a variety of IDEs, including lesser-used editors like Atom or Vim. However, the process may require extra time and expertise. Unlike Copilot’s easy onboarding, some debugging may be needed with Tabby plugins—making it more appealing to seasoned developers comfortable with troubleshooting.

    Ease of Use: Setup, Documentation, and Troubleshooting

    GitHub Copilot: Plug-and-Play Excellence

    To set up GitHub Copilot, users simply need to install the appropriate IDE plugin, link it to their GitHub account, and select a subscription plan. Most developers are fully operational in less than five minutes, with the streamlined setup rated highly by users.

    Tabby: Built for Experienced Users

    Tabby, on the other hand, requires additional technical expertise. In many cases, new users must configure local Docker containers or manage server resources based on their needs. Furthermore, its documentation—while sufficient for experienced individuals—falls short of the level of support expected by beginners.
    Example: If hosting Tabby on AWS, anticipate an additional hosting cost of $30-$50/month for a mid-tier instance, compared to Copilot’s comprehensive infrastructure included in the package.
